To be honest, there's only one thing I liked about the Radiance Light System, and that was how it looked at dawn/dusk. *So* beautiful, and I would love it if it were possible to just have those changes without anything else. Radiance Light System makes it nearly impossible to play the game without a great deal of lighting, which is a HUGE hassle. Night is almost completely pitch black. It may be more "realistic" but it also makes building a huge hassle.

I once installed that light mod, waaaay back before I even thought about making a story with my sims. I had just discovered MTS and was like a kid at a candy store trying out all the "OMG SHINY!" stuff in there. Maybe that's an useful mod for stories, but I hated it as a gamer. When I realized I was placing 6 windows and 10 lamps per room just to make the game bearable, I took it out forever.
